2026 prize money

$1,461,245

Singles, across 12 singles draws Setlex prices

Their biggest payday of the season was $780,000 at US Open.

Every 2026 tournament

TournamentFinishedEarnedSeason to date
Brisbane InternationalATP 25010 Jan 2026Semifinal$38,885$38.9K
ASB ClassicATP 25014 Jan 2026Round of 16$12,285$51.2K
Dallas OpenATP 50011 Feb 2026Round of 16$41,435$92.6K
Delray Beach OpenATP 25018 Feb 2026Round of 16$12,285$104.9K
BNP Paribas OpenMasters 100011 Mar 2026Round of 16$105,720$210.6K
Miami OpenMasters 100024 Mar 2026Round of 16$105,720$316.3K
US Men's Clay Court ChampionshipATP 2502 Apr 2026Round of 16$12,285$328.6K
French OpenGrand Slam29 May 2026Round of 32$187,000$515.6K
Citi OpenATP 50031 Jul 2026Quarterfinal$67,655$583.3K
National Bank OpenMasters 10007 Aug 2026Round of 32$61,865$645.1K
Cincinnati OpenMasters 100016 Aug 2026Round of 64$36,110$681.2K
US OpenGrand Slam13 Sep 2026Quarterfinal$780,000$1.5M

6 further 2026 tournaments are on Alex Michelsen’s record with no published prize sheet, so they are absent here rather than counted as nothing.

The career total and the 2026 headline are the ATP’s own published figures, quoted as they stand — they count doubles and every tier, including the ones Setlex does not track, and move when the tour updates them. The tournament lines are this site’s arithmetic instead: each tournament’s published per-round singles prize, read at the round Alex Michelsenreached. A cheque written in another currency is converted at the European Central Bank’s reference rate for the tournament’s day, recorded when the tournament was priced and never recomputed; the amount as paid is beside it. Nothing here is an average of what a tier usually pays.
